DOCTOR'S NARROW ESCAPE.
MOTOR-TANK EXPLODES.
[BY TELEGRAPH. —OWN CORRESPONDENT.] NGARUAVfAHIA. Friday. While Dr. Martin was driving his car on the Whatawhata Road yesterday the tank exploded through the fusing of an electric wire. The doctor escaped injury, but the car was destroyed.
